Through Clear, Illuminating Excercises, This Bestselling Book Stimulates New Ways To Think About Color, Generating Responses That Unlock Personal Creativity And Allow Artists To Express Themselves With Paint As Never Before. Readers Are Shown How The Interplay Of Complementary Hues Can Trigger Vibrations; How The Push And Pull Of Warm And Cool Colors Can Create A Feeling Of Space; How To Disguise One Color In A Scene To Accent Another; And Many More Tidbits Of Colorful Advice.
